This post is kind of a hodge podge of polish. I wanted to do nail striping skittles but I also wanted to use some blue and purple polishes... and clearly was too lazy to do a separate mani for each color so.... the striping tape skittle mani was born.
Ring- I used nail striping tape and taped off my nail in a plaid pattern and used Wet N Wild Disturbia over it. Disturbia is a deep purple with lots of shimmer to it, it really demands attention and was a good contrast between Stream of Wonder and Grape Juice.
I started out with 2 coats of Rumples Wiggin' and a coat of SV to dry it fast, then taped off with nail striping tape (did you see I added some to my giveaway?) and painted the next color from the tape and below to the tip of my nail, then added a coat of SV. Lather, rinse, repeat....
